Day 01 Arrive Mumbai
Upon arrrival you will be met and transferred to Mumbai’s Chhatrapati Shivaji Terminus to board the train. You will begin your enchanting journey to the royal city of the Gaekwads, Vadodara. (D)
Day 02 In Vadodara
Drive to the World Heritage site of Champaner-Pavagadh Archaeological Park, an ancient town full of ruins. Enjoy high tea at the magnificent Laxmi Vilas Palace – the exquisite residence of the Royal family. (B,L,D)
Day 03 In Bhavnagar
The train arrives at Bhavnagar. Enjoy an excursion to Palitana, famed for its spectacular cluster of Jain temples exquisitely carved in marble. (B,L,D)
Day 04 In Sasan Gir
In Sasan Gir, an expert naturalist accompanies you to the national park, home to the only surviving `Lions of Asia’ and a myriad variety of birds and other creatures. (B,L,D)
Day 05 In Little Rann of Kutch
Enjoy a cross-desert safari across the Little Rann of Kutch looking for wild ass and water birds. Also, visit the settlements and villages, renowned for their traditional embroideries and weaving. (B,L,D)
Day 06 In Modhera
Early morning, visit the 11th centurySun Temple and the Rani-ka-Vav step well, the finest example of subterranean architecture
for water management. (B,L,D)
Day 07 In Nashik
After breakfast head to Pandu Leni which is considered one of the most ancient Jani and Buddhist cave temples in India. Some of this set of 24 caes date back to 1st century BC. In the afternoon visit the Grover Zampa vineyards for a tour and tasting. (B, L, D)
Day 08 Depart Mumbai
Arrive back into Mumbai and disembark the train. You will then be transferred to the airport for your return flight. (B)
